3 Angels Broadcasting Network was one of the original Sky Angel Channels and until the transponder failed that they were on, it seemed they were still a significant part of the Sky Angel lineup. I, as well as others I know, first signed on to Sky Angel to receive 3ABN when 3ABN went from their old C Band transmission to KU band (rather then buying the new receiver for FTA). Last I heard 3ABN is one of the top religious/health . . . broadcasters and where this is much of the market for Sky Angle I would think that they would again carry 3ABN now that they can have more channels with IPTV. I realize that 3ABN is available as Free to Air on AMC 4, 3ABN is part of the "Glorystar" lineup, 3ABN is on Dish Network (61.5), 3ABN is available on the internet, and 3ABN has their own IPTV system, but it would be nice to have them on Sky Angel IPTV. The President of the Adventist Denomination ran a full page ad in the denominations principle magazine "Adventist Review" encouraging church members across North America to buy the Sky Angel system back when Sky Angel first started broadcasting. I don't know how many Adventists did that but I suspect it was significant. SafeTV, which is operated by Adventists, will continue to be in the SkyAngel line up so I don't think Sky Angel has anything against Adventists.

I think the Adventist church and Sky Angel have simply went their own ways. 3ABN has gotten on with DISH and started their own IPTV service. 3ABN may not even want to be on Sky Angel's IPTV line up at this point. The Adventist church has started the Hope Channel and they, may have more interest in Sky Angel's IPTV service than 3ABN does.
